Abstract :
A high-linearity optical receiver with background-light-AGC for high PAPR signals is presented. The integrated BiCMOS optical receiver consists of a TIA with AGC, a linear amplifier and a line driver. The receiver THD is 1.7% and the third-order intermodulation is 50% dBc at 20% MHz and at an input optical power of %3.5% dBm. The third-order intermodulation decreases to 40% dBc at 100% MHz.
